BCAW Elects New Board Members, Honors Excellence at 2022 Annual Meeting/Trade Show
The Bowling Centers Association of Wisconsin (BCAW) held a successful 2022 Annual Meeting, Awards Luncheon, Conference and Trade Show Oct. 3 at the Wintergreen Conference Center in Wisconsin Dells.
Outgoing BCAW President Erik Gialdella kicked off the meeting’s official business portion with opening remarks and an overview of recent Board actions. BCAW Executive Director Roger Dalkin provided a financial report and program updates. Guest speaker Don Hildebrand – Wisconsin State USBC Association Manager – discussed the schedule of Wisconsin USBC bowling events for the upcoming 2022-23 season including the State Open Championship, Wisconsin Women’s Championship, Youth Masters and Badger Queens. Hildebrand also presented information about the Wisconsin State USBC Scholarship Program for high school seniors ($50,000 in scholarship funds) as well as the USBC Tiered Center Certification Program launching in January 2023.
Posnanski, Jr., Patterson Lead Election Slate
The selection of new President Hank Posnanski, Jr. and Vice President Daniel Patterson highlighted elections that were conducted for the BCAW Board of Directors. In addition, elections were held for three director positions on the BCAW Board for a two-year term. With Patterson’s election as Vice President, his Board seat became vacant and will be filled by appointment from Posnanski.
The following were elected by unanimous action of the membership:

- BCAW President: Hank Posnanski, Jr., Bluemound Bowl, Brookfield
- Vice President: Daniel Patterson, Buzz Social, Green Bay
- Directors (1-4):
- Steve Cieslewicz, Whitetail Lanes, Amherst Junction
- Cary Serwe, King Pin Lanes, Campbellsport
- Chuck Torosian, River City Lanes, Waterford
- Vacant seat to be filled by incoming President

Luncheon honors Awards of Excellence winners
The 2022 BCAW Award of Excellence recipients were recognized at the “Celebration of Excellence” Luncheon.
Proprietor David Bardon, Youth Bowling Directors John Breunig and Cher Breunig, and former BCAW Executive Director Yvonne Bennett were honored as this year’s recipients based on their outstanding dedication to center promotion, youth bowling, coaching and raising awareness of the sport.
Honorees shared inspiring personal stories as well as keys to their success. Joshua Bardon accepted the BCAW Award of Excellence (Over 12 Lane centers) for his father, David, a longtime proprietor with Bardon Bowling Centers who has maintained an active role in the bowling industry at all levels. The Breunigs – who together earned a Special Award of Excellence – shared their passion for coaching youth bowlers and how rewarding that experience has been in their lives. Accepting a Special Award of Excellence on behalf of Yvonne Bennet was her husband, David, who shared a heartfelt story about how the couple met at a bowling center and told the audience of the incredible dedication, commitment and passion Yvonne has displayed for the sport of bowling.
Informative seminars hit the mark
Two educational seminars gave proprietors and guests a chance to learn about hiring the right employees and lane topography.
Kelly Bednar of The Bowling Proprietors’ Association of America (BPAA) outlined strategies proprietors can use to hire and keep staff members in his session “Talent Acquisition – Recruiting, Training and Retaining.”
In a concurrent seminar, Silas Whitener and Brad Mezo from Bowling Voodoo discussed lane topography and what it means for bowling centers. It’s important for proprietors to consider that the overall shape of their lane beds affects ball motion, fair play and lane maintenance, they said.
